Sunday Story…Consistency

The single most important facet of your fitness journey is consistency. Consistency may be the most important facet in a lot of things. But in the fitness realm consistency reigns supreme.

We can talk about reps and sets and exercises, and tempo ad nauseum. But those things do not mean squat if you don’t show up regularly. The hardest day was your first day. After you walk through the door the first time, knowing little and unsure of what to expect, every day after that is easier.

You will have days when you don’t want to go to the gym, we all do. Yes, even Ellie and me. What do you do on those days? You go anyway. You show up and do work. Every day is not going to be your best day. But your worst day in the gym is better than the regret and recriminations you will experience when you don’t go because you just aren’t “feeling” it. Think back…have you ever felt worse after a workout that you completed than you did before you started even though you really didn’t want to do it? I think not.

This is why we have a calendar. Plan your trips to the box on your calendar. Next week I will be there (fill in the blanks!) And then, come hell or high water, you show up. If you are committed to show up 4 days a week then get here 4 days a week. Whatever your level of commitment you owe it to yourself to fulfill that commitment. Having integrity with yourself may be one of the best things you can do for yourself.

Consistency is king. Without consistency, your results will suffer. With consistency, your results will soar. Get in here.
